Windows与Linux操作系统比较:哪个操作系统更适合开发者

时间:2025-12-06 分类:操作系统

在当今技术迅速发展的时代,操作系统的选择显得尤为重要。对于开发者来说,选择适合自己工作的操作系统不仅能够提升工作效率,还能影响到学习和实践的深度。Windows与Linux是目前最广泛使用的两大操作系统,各自具备独特的优势与不足。Windows因其友好的用户界面与广泛的软件支持,成为了许多新手开发者的首选。而Linux凭借其开源特性和灵活性,逐渐赢得了专业开发者的青睐。在后续的内容中,我们将深入探讨这两种操作系统在开发者使用中的表现,以帮助开发者根据需求做出更合理的选择。

Windows与Linux操作系统比较:哪个操作系统更适合开发者

Windows操作系统以其易用性受到众多初学者的喜爱。它的图形用户界面直观,许多开发工具和环境,如Visual Studio等,都是在Windows下运行的。尤其是在开发Windows应用或使用Microsoft的技术栈时,选择Windows无疑是较为便捷的选择。许多商业软件和游戏的开发也多在Windows环境下进行,这为开发者提供了丰富的资源。

相比之下,Linux操作系统则更适合喜欢开源文化和系统自定义的开发者。Linux的命令行工具强大,适合进行深度编程与服务器管理。对于需要进行网络编程、嵌入式开发或是大数据处理的开发者而言,Linux显然更具优势。使用Linux,开发者可以轻松访问内核层,进行比较底层的开发工作。Linux拥有大量的开发工具与框架,使得开发环境的搭建与维护更加灵活高效。

开发者的社区支持在选择操作系统时也不可忽视。Windows社区虽然庞大,但Linux的社区则以其开源特性聚集了大量热爱技术和分享知识的开发者。许多开发者在遇到问题时,更倾向于在Linux社区寻求帮助,这种资源的交换与共享极大地促进了技术的发展。

安全性方面,Linux通常被认为比Windows更为安全。这主要得益于其开源特性,任何人都可以对代码进行审查和修改,及时发现安全漏洞。而Windows虽然近年来也加强了安全措施,但由于其市场占有率高,成为黑客攻击的主要目标。

选择Windows还是Linux作为开发环境,主要取决于开发者的具体需求和个人偏好。Windows更适合简单上手以及应用开发,而Linux则适合追求深度编程、服务器维护和开源项目的开发者。理清自己的需求,才能找到最适合自己的操作系统,助力开发者在技术的浪潮中不断前行。